Wallaceburg, located in Chatham-Kent, offers a tranquil lifestyle with a strong sense of community. The average commute time to the nearest major city, Windsor, is approximately one hour and 15 minutes, making it a feasible option for those who work in the city but prefer a quieter home life. Residents enjoy a variety of outdoor activities, including boating and fishing on the Sydenham River, and the annual WAMBO (Wallaceburg Antique Motor and Boat Outing) event is a highlight of the summer season. The town's rich history is evident in its well-preserved Victorian architecture and the Wallaceburg and District Museum. However, don't expect the hustle and bustle of a big city; Wallaceburg prides itself on its slower pace and small-town charm. The local economy is primarily driven by agriculture and manufacturing, and the town is known for its friendly, hardworking residents. Despite its modest size, Wallaceburg boasts a variety of amenities, including restaurants, shops, and healthcare facilities, ensuring residents have everything they need close to home.
